About Ogallala Lake
Ogallala Lake provides a spacious outdoor setting in Keith County, Nebraska, near the town of Ogallala. Covering 574 acres, this lake offers a broad water surface that invites visitors to enjoy its open environment. Its shallow nature, with no recorded maximum depth, shapes the lake's calm and accessible character, making it a distinct spot in the Nebraska landscape. The lake is surrounded by natural Nebraska scenery and lies close to Lake McConaughy State Recreation Area, adding a layer of outdoor context for those exploring the region.
